March in Makhmur camp against isolation

A march was held in the Makhmur refugee camp to protest the aggravated isolation imposed on Kurdish leader Abdullah Öcalan. Making a speech on behalf of the people, Filiz Budak said their protests and actions would continue.

Makhmur (Maxmur)- A march was held in the Makhmur refugee camp to protest the aggravated isolation imposed on Kurdish leader Abdullah Öcalan with the participation of hundreds of people living in the camp. The march started in front of the Martyrs Families’ Institution and ended in front of the UN Makhmur office. After the march, Filiz Budak, Co-chair of the People's Assembly of the Makhmur refugee camp, made a speech on behalf of the people participating in the march.
